Description
Configuration Engineer required to maintain the database for all equipment, documents and drawings for Navy Surface ships.
As a Configuration Engineer your main responsibilities will involve:
- Maintain the database for all equipment, documents and drawings of Royal Navy Surface Ships.
- Structuring and recording data in order to maintain a future ship fit definition for each ship.
- Liaise with internal and external stakeholders to establish sufficient knowledge of the requirements for recording data relating to the various ships, systems and equipment.
- Preparation of project working instructions and co-ordination of the associated documentation for each ship.
- Visit stakeholder sites and carry out on-board ship equipment validations at various locations throughout the UK.
As a Configuration Engineer your skills and qualifications will ideally include:
- Educated to ONC level or equivalent calibre
- Data entry approximately 6000 plus keystrokes per hour
- Background within a Naval/Technical Engineering and familiar with ship systems (Mechanical, Electrical and Weapons Systems).
- A well developed understanding of technical drawings and their significance to each ship and the through-life support
- A general awareness of naval ship construction and ship systems layout would be beneficial.
- An understanding of quality systems ideally SSDD Knowledge (application currently in use) would be highly desirable
